Abstract :
Sometimes making finite element analysis only by one software is a hard thing. Because one software is not good at every work. Therefore, we choose ProE, HyperMesh and ANSYS software to model, mesh and calculate respectively and that can exert their corresponding advantages. Model can be imported and exported among softwares accurately with software interface. In ProE, surface modeling and model simplify can reduce modify and geometry clean work in HyperMesh. In HyperMesh, firstly we classify and manage model surface, then check surface edges, and then mesh automatically. We must check element quality to ensure successful calculation in ANSYS. Finally solve by ANSYS. Working process, problems and solution is proposed. The given example of a vehicle oil tank shows that this method and process are feasible and make operation simply, calculation accurately and working efficiently. Especially they are suitable for complex model.
